Web6. okt 2024 · Reflecting About the x-axis Consider the graphs of y = x 2 and y = − x 2. x-Axis Reflection Rule Rule 5: − f ( x) = f ( x) reflected about the x-axis. 5. Reflecting About the y-axis Exercise Use the calculator to graph y = x and y = − x y-Axis Reflection Rule Rule 6: f ( − x) = f ( x) reflected about the y-axis. 6. WebAnother transformation that can be applied to a function is a reflection over the x – or y -axis. A vertical reflection reflects a graph vertically across the x -axis, while a horizontal reflection reflects a graph horizontally across the y -axis.
